Cooperative Agreements Louisiana State University has general exchange agreements with University of Marburg and student exchange agreements with University of Jena (Frederich Schiller University), University of Mainz, University of Tuebingen and University of Bonn.
Faculty Engagements Dr. Harald Leder, Angelika Roy-Goldman and Andrea Morshäuser will direct LSU in Germany, a short-term study-abroad program focusing on history and language courses in summer 2011. The program will be based in Nuremberg and Brannenberg, both in the German state of Bavaria. Dr. Leder has directed LSU in Germany for close to 10 years.
Paige Davis will direct Encountering Engineering in Europe, a short-term study-abroad program focusing on civil and industrial engineering courses in summer 2011. Encountering Engineering in Europe will run parallel with LSU in Germany.
